Understanding Local SEO
Local SEO refers to the practice of optimizing a business’s online presence to attract more customers from relevant local searches. This typically involves focusing on search terms that include a geographical component, such as “best coffee shop in Karachi” or “plumbing services near me.” By targeting these localized keywords, businesses can ensure that they appear in search results when potential customers are looking for specific products or services in their area.
The increasing reliance on mobile devices for search has paved the way for locals to find businesses quickly and efficiently. As such, having a robust local SEO strategy is no longer an option but a necessity for small and medium businesses aiming to build brand recognition and drive revenue.

How Local SEO Works
Local SEO works by optimizing various online platforms to make a business more visible in local search results. This involves several key components:
| Key Components | Description |
|---|---|
| Google My Business | Claiming and optimizing your Google My Business listing ensures that accurate information about your business appears in local search results and maps. |
| Local Keywords | Using local keywords in your website content, meta descriptions, and tags allows search engines to understand your relevance to local areas. |
| Online Reviews | Encouraging satisfied customers to leave positive reviews enhances your online reputation and can improve your local search rankings. |
| Local Citations | Listing your business in local online directories bolsters your credibility and improves search engine visibility. |
Local SEO Strategies for Small Businesses
Implementing effective local SEO strategies can help small and medium businesses gain a competitive edge. Here are some tried-and-true techniques:
- Optimize Google My Business: Ensure your business profile is complete with accurate details like address, phone number, hours of operation, and high-quality images.
- Utilize Local Keywords: Integrate local keywords into your website content, headings, and meta descriptions to align with user searches.
- Encourage Customer Reviews: Actively seek reviews and testimonials from happy customers. Aim for a mix of quality and quantity to enhance your online reputation.
- Engage with Local Content: Create blog posts or articles that relate to local events or news, which can increase your relevance in local searches.

Tracking the Success of Local SEO Efforts
To measure the effectiveness of your local SEO strategies, consider utilizing tools such as Google Analytics and Google Search Console. These platforms provide insights into various metrics, including website traffic, bounce rates, and user behavior. Key performance indicators (KPIs) to monitor include:
- Organic listings in local search results.
- Your business ranking for target local keywords.
- The number of inbound calls and online bookings.
- Review ratings and volume.
Analyzing this data will help you fine-tune your strategies and enhance your local SEO performance over time.
